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5951247116 1561 4177870118
9881 147
9881 147
97512 370005 29052476
All about undefined
Interested in learning more?
9881 147
97512 370005 29052476
See more
6861674061 137
557420803 773 279
See more
12 302044 544
581523 50 571411613
See more